What Is Modern Home Design?

Modern home design refers to an end-to-end planning philosophy that focuses on open spaces, natural light, and clean geometry. Rather than following older architectural trends, modern design removes visual clutter in place of intentional choices. This style gained traction in the early 20th century and keeps growing as technology advance.

At its foundation, modern home design relies on several defining ideas: open floor plans, large windows, geometric structural forms, and honest use of wood, stone, and metal. These design choices combine to create homes that look spacious and grounded. Modern home design also includes smart home technology as a natural part of the home.

In practical terms, modern home design looks like thoughtful room placement that reduce wasted square footage. It additionally covers finish selections that age gracefully, reducing upkeep costs. The Modern Home Design Procedure Step by Step

  1. Discovery and Goal Setting — The process begins with a thorough consultation where our team understands your household priorities, investment range, and must-have features. That first meeting establishes the framework for all future planning.
  2. Site Analysis and Feasibility Review — Our builders review your lot dimensions and topography, municipal regulations, and environmental factors to clarify what modern home design approaches will deliver the most value for your property.
  3. Schematic Design and Concept Development — Our design team produce preliminary floor plans that bring to life your vision and priorities. Clients examine these concepts and suggest revisions so the layout moves closer to exactly what you want.
  4. Deep Dive into Materials, Systems, and Specifications — When the floor plan is set, we move into refined planning — selecting finishes like structural elements and interior surfaces. That stage is where modern home design really takes shape.
  5. Permit Submittal and City Approvals — Brother & Brother Builders handles the complete permitting workflow on your behalf. The city's permit offices require comprehensive plan sets, and our established process ensures this stage progress without unnecessary delays.
  6. Active Construction and Site Oversight — After regulatory sign-off, building starts. The build team keep up detailed updates throughout, ensuring that modern home design standards are met on site.
  7. Project Close-Out and Client Delivery — Before handing over your new space, our team performs a comprehensive close-out review to make sure every detail of your modern home design meets the approved plans.

Modern Home Design Frequently Asked Questions

How long does a modern home design project generally last from start to finish?

The timeline for a modern home design project varies based on the complexity of the build. A full new construction project generally spans 12 to 18 months from initial design through move-in. Partial updates may finish in as little as half a year based on how much work is involved.

How well do modern home design finishes age?

Properties constructed using professional modern home design are constructed to endure for generations. Building products typical of modern design — fiber cement siding, engineered hardwood, metal roofing — are selected for their exceptional durability. With proper care, a home designed using these principles will stay attractive and efficient well into the future.
